This scheme is for senior citizens (60-80 years) and super senior citizens (80 years and above). Under this, a lump sum amount of less than two crore rupees can be deposited.
There are two types of options
This special 600 day FD scheme of PNB is available with and without premature withdrawal. PNB is offering an interest rate of 7 per cent per annum under the option of premature withdrawal. Apart from this, there is an interest rate of 7.50 percent for senior citizens and 7.80 percent for super senior citizens.
At the same time, without premature withdrawal option, interest is being received at the rate of 7.05 percent per annum. In this, there is an interest rate of 7.55 percent for senior citizens and 7.85 percent for super senior citizens. In this way, PNB is now offering a maximum interest rate of 7.85 percent on the special FD scheme.

Earlier, Punjab National Bank (PNB) had increased the fixed deposit rate on 25 October. PNB had increased the FD rate for the second time this month. The benefit of increased interest rates is being given on FDs of less than Rs 2 crore. The new rates of PNB’s fixed deposits have come into effect from 26 October. Earlier, Punjab National Bank had revised the FD interest rates on October 19, 2022. According to PNB, 4.50% interest is being received on FDs maturing in 46 to 90 days. FD interest for this period has been increased by 75 basis points. The new rate has been implemented from 26 October.
